Urgent Appeal for Next Weekend

The sad, cruel situation in Kosovo, reported in the news media, moves all people of good will to compassion for their brothers and sisters who are suffering this terrible crisis. This is a moment requiring fervent prayer and financial sacrifice. For this reason, our Cardinal-Archbishop requests us to conduct a special appeal for the relief of the Kosovo refugees, an appeal to be made as soon as possible due to the great need for food and medical supplies.

The Second Collection next weekend, April 24th-25th, will benefit this very urgent cause. Your generous contributions would be most appreciated. Also, please keep in mind and prayer the sufferings of all those forced from their homes, as well as those who find themselves in harm's way during this crisis, including members of our armed services.

75th Anniversary Celebration

The joy of the Easter Season is compounded for us by our Parish Celebration of the 75th Anniversary of Founding next Sunday, April 25th, 1999. A Solemn Mass of Thanksgiving will be offered at 1:00pm in our Parish Church, with The Most Reverend Joseph F. Martino, Auxiliary Bishop of Philadelphia, as the Principal Concelebrant. Other Concelebrants will include Monsignor James McDonough, Regional Vicar for Chester County, Father Roman Kozacheson, O.F.M. Cap., a native son of our Parish, and Father John Ferrence, O.S.A., guest homilist for the occasion. Other priest-friends of the Parish, too, will join them at the altar.

Added to the beautiful music of our Parish Adult Choir and organist will be the talented instrumentation of the five piece Basilica Brass. It should truly be an uplifting Liturgy that rivals the very worship of the angels in heaven. You are encouraged to arrive early for a special Pre-Mass Musical Program beginning at 12:30pm. Our talented singers and musicians will present a medley of sacred song in keeping with our Anniversary Celebration.

A 75th Anniversary is a blessed moment in time and eternity. It is a remembering, rejoicing, renewing moment for the Parish Family of St. Joseph. It is a moment for us all to be the Church with and for one another. Come, share in the grace and gladness, faith and fellowship of this blessed moment!
